Book excerpt: The production of J/[psi] mesons in continuum ee− annihilations has been studied with the BABAR detector at energies near the [Upsilon](4S) resonance, approximately 10.6 GeV. The mesons are distinguished from J/[psi] production in B decays through their center-of-mass momentum and energy. We measure the cross section ee− 2!J/[psi] X to be 2.52 ± 0.21 ± 0.21 pb; for momentum above 2 GeV/c, it is 1.87 ± 0.10 ± 0.15 pb. We set a 90% confidence level upper limit on the branching fraction for direct [Upsilon](4S) 2!J/[psi] X decays at 4.3 x 10−4.

Book excerpt: This paper reports the measurement of J/psi meson production in proton-proton (pp) and proton-lead (pPb) collisions at a center-of-mass energy per nucleon pair of 5.02 TeV by the CMS experiment at the LHC. The data samples used in the analysis correspond to integrated luminosities of 28 inverse picobarns and 35 inverse nanobarns for pp and pPb collisions, respectively. Prompt and nonprompt J/psi mesons, the latter issuing from the decay of B mesons, are measured in their dimuon decay channels. Available in PDF, EPUB and Kindle. Book excerpt: A measurement of the J/psi and psi(2S) production cross sections in pp collisions at sqrt(s)=7 TeV with the CMS experiment at the LHC is presented. The data sample corresponds to an integrated luminosity of 37 inverse picobarns. Using a fit to the invariant mass and decay length distributions, production cross sections have been measured separately for prompt and non-prompt charmonium states, as a function of the meson transverse momentum in several rapidity ranges. In addition, cross sections restricted to the acceptance of the CMS detector are given, which are not affected by the polarization of the charmonium states. The ratio of the differential production cross sections of the two states, where systematic uncertainties largely cancel, is also determined. The branching fraction of the inclusive B to psi(2S) X decay is extracted from the ratio of the non-prompt cross sections to be: BR(B to psi(2S) X) = (3.08 +/- 0.12(stat.+syst.) +/- 0.13(theor.) +/- 0.42(BR[PDG])) 10-̂3.

Book excerpt: The simultaneous production of two J/psi mesons has been significantly observed in proton-proton collisions at a center-of-mass energy of 7 TeV with the CMS detector. The two J/psi mesons are fully reconstructed in their decay to muons. The signal yield is extracted with an extended maximum likelihood fit based on four event variables. A method was developed to correct for detector acceptances and efficiencies based on the measured momenta of the J/psi and their decay muons to maintain the least model dependence possible. The measurement is performed in an acceptance region defined by the individual J/psi transverse momentum and rapidity. From the measured signal yield of 446 events corresponding to an integrated luminosity of 4:7 inverse femtobarn. The total cross section is found to be 1:49 nanobarn, with 0:07 statistical and 0:13 nb systematic error, and unpolarizaed production was assumed. Most predictions for particle production at the LHC assume dominance of single parton interaction for proton-proton collisions, which can be tested with the final state measured in this analysis. The differential cross section is measured in bins of the double J/psi invariant mass, the double J/psi transverse momentum, and the absolute difference in rapidity of the two J/psi. The reconstruction of the four charged muon trajectories heavily relies on the Pixel subdetector located close to the beampipe. Systematic studies with cosmic muons and tracks from collision events are presented. The development of the Pixel RawToDigi package, data quality monitoring packages, commissioning studies of Pixel data and tracks in first collisions, and realistic simulations of decay signals in the pixel subdetector were all performed as a part of this dissertation work.
